Scotts Turf Builder Rapid Grass Sun and Shade Mix – Combination Grass Seed & Lawn Fertilizer, Covers Up to 2,800 sq. ft., 5.6 lb. Review

I tested Scotts Turf Builder Rapid Grass Sun and Shade Mix on thin grass spots in my yard last season. I wanted fast growth without buying separate fertilizer and seed bags. This mix made the job easy for me. I noticed fresh green blades in less than two weeks with regular watering. The grass also blended well with my older lawn. My Personal Experience with Grass Seed Blends For Overseeding Existing Turf

My lawn looked tired after summer heat left many dry spots. I wanted a quick fix before colder weather arrived. After using Scotts Turf Builder Rapid Grass Sun and Shade Mix, I started seeing small green shoots sooner than expected. The thin parts slowly turned fuller each day.

I spread the mix during mild weather and watered every morning. The fertilizer seemed to help the grass grow evenly across the yard. I also noticed fewer empty patches compared to other seed blends I used before. The lawn looked soft and fresh after a few weeks.

One thing I appreciated was how natural the new grass looked beside the older turf. The color matched better than cheaper mixes I tried in the past. I even used some near my walkway where the grass gets heavy foot traffic. Those spots recovered nicely.

Comparing with Other Brands

I tested a few cheaper grass seed mixes before trying this Scotts product. Many of those blends took longer to sprout and needed separate lawn food. Scotts saved me from buying extra fertilizer because it already came mixed inside the bag.

Some budget brands also produced uneven color across my lawn. This blend created a more balanced look between old and new grass. I also noticed stronger growth in partly shaded areas where some other seeds struggled badly.

Another difference was speed. A few competing products stayed patchy for weeks. Scotts Turf Builder Rapid Grass gave me faster filling results, especially after regular watering. That made my lawn look healthier much sooner.
